Why do periods hurt so much on the first day?
This pain is caused by natural chemicals called prostaglandins that are made in the lining of the uterus. Prostaglandins cause the muscles and blood vessels of the uterus to contract. On the first day of a period, the level of prostaglandins is high.What's a Pamprin?

What do doctors prescribe for severe menstrual cramps?
Prescription NSAIDs available for the treatment of menstrual cramps include mefenamic acid (Ponstel).NSAIDs that are available OTC are:
- ibuprofen (Advil, Midol IB, Motrin, Nuprin, and others);
- naproxen sodium (Aleve, Anaprox); and.
- ketoprofen (Actron, Orudis KT).
